Basic Information
| Product Name | 4-(8-Chloro-2-Cyano-5,6-Dihydro-11H-Benzo[5,6]Cyclohepta[1,2-B]Pyridin-11-Ylidene)-1-Piperidinecarboxylic Acid Ethyl Ester |
| CAS No. | 860010-31-7 |
| Molecular Formula | C23H20ClN3O2 |
| Molecular Weight | 405.88 g/mol |
| Synonyms | Ethyl 4-[(8-chloro-2-cyano-5,6-dihydro-11H-benzo[5,6]cyclohepta[1,2-b]pyridin-11-ylidene)]piperidine-1-carboxylate; UNII-8V8T8QY9QN; 8V8T8QY9QN; BCPE; 4-(8-Chloro-2-cyano-5,6-dihydro-11H-benzo[5,6]cyclohepta[1,2-b]pyridin-11-ylidene)piperidine-1-carboxylic acid ethyl ester; 1-Piperidinecarboxylic acid, 4-[(8-chloro-2-cyano-5,6-dihydro-11H-benzo[5,6]cyclohepta[1,2-b]pyridin-11-ylidene)]-, ethyl ester; Ethyl 4-(8-chloro-2-cyano-5,6-dihydrobenzo[5,6]cyclohepta[1,2-b]pyridin-11(11H)-ylidene)piperidine-1-carboxylate |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(typically 15-25°C). This compound is light-sensitive (store away from light) and may be hygroscopic (moisture-sensitive); therefore, containers should be kept sealed under an inert atmosphere if necessary to prevent degradation.
